Desk by Gordon Bunshaft Manufactured by Knoll for SOM Architect Chase Bank

About the Item

Desk has a solid polished steel frame that supports a 1.25 inch marble top with thin wooden drawers on each side. The desk was made for Chase Bank Corporate Office NYC in 1960s. Two available.
